We are pursuing an exceptional Executive Director of Facility Services to direct the overall hospital Facility Planning, Property Management, Engineering Operations, Environmental Services, and Laundry Services!  As the Executive Director of Facility Services, you will: » Provide leadership abilities and strategic direction for master facility planning; capital project administration and management; facility lease analysis, negotiations, and management; assists with property planning needs and acquisitions » Be responsible for planning safe and efficient facilities in conformity with fire, safety, sanitary, operational, and medical requirements and organizational goals » Maintain financial and team accountcapability for Engineering, Environmental Services, Laundry, Facility Construction, and Planning and Property Management departments » Lead the facility planning department in establ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with the Kootenai Health leadership abilities team and other departments to provide a unified approach to healthcare facility service planning and project management » Enforce environmental regulations and ensures compliance. Provides quality inspections of finished work product » Ensure construction work is being performed to job plan standards » Ensure compliance with appropriate safety, OSHA, DNV (NIOSH), Idaho Public Works, and other regulatory standards » Function as a facilitator and change agent  Kootenai Health has a lot to offer you, including: » Expanding service lines with room for future career development and continuous learning opportunities » Magnet Status - Kootenai has maintained MagnetTM status since 2006. The organization provides a comprehensive range of medical services. Our main campus is located in Coeur d'Alene, Idaho, and includes a 330-bed community-owned hospital. Kootenai Health is accredited by DNV, the College of American Pathologists (CAP), and holds Magnet Designation for nursing excellence.
